Q3 Planning Note — Legacy Pricing

For the incoming director: legacy customers on the old Brantell Suite tiers will see a 9% uplift effective next quarter. Notices go out in week two; renewals team at the Calder office is briefed. Churn modelling suggests minimal attrition. Context on the wider strategy follows below.

management briefing: The pricing group signed off on a budget of $378.8 million for Project Kasael.

- [ ] Step 7: Archive cold storage buckets (Glacierline tier). Confirm both ceremony witnesses are present, verify bucket manifests match the Oxbow ledger, then seal the archive key shares. Plugin authors may observe but not handle shares. Once sealed, the archive index itself is encrypted and can only be reopened with the passphrase below.

vault phrase of badup-hahig = tamael-aldael-kelmir-istael-fenok-istwyn-tamius-jorath-oliion

### CI Note: Farelight Pricing Experiment

If the Farelight experiment suite fails on the `variant-assignment` stage, it is almost always a stale bucketing fixture rather than real breakage. Regenerate fixtures with the refresh script in the experiment repo, then re-run only that stage. Never force-merge past this check — mispriced variants have reached staging before. The last known-good pipeline build is noted below.

session token of yajof-bagef = htk4_937d

**Mgmt Meeting Minutes — Retiring the Brightline Range**

Quick recap for sales leads at Fenholt Supplies: we agreed to retire the Brightline fixture range by year-end. Remaining stock moves to clearance pricing next month, and accounts on standing orders get migrated to the Lumetta range. Trade-in incentives were approved in principle. The confidential note on next steps sits just below.

board note of bajof-bajeg: The pricing group signed off on a budget of $13.4 million for Project Sildor. The renewal with Lamixek Holdings closes at $48.9 million a year, 49 percent above the last contract.